The Eureka Heritage Society's
Publications

The Eureka Heritage Society publishes two periodicals, Architectural Legacy, edited by Kathy Dillon and The Heritage Herald edited by Kay Bradford.
Both are issued quarterly and a printed copy is sent out to all members. Membership has its privileges.

green book The Green Book
In addition to the periodicals,
the Society also published in 1987
the outstanding document,
"Eureka, An Architectural View".
Also known as The Green Book, it contains photographs of 1200 homes and is considered one of the finest collection of details on historic homes ever published.
A limited number of these books still exist and can be purchased directly from The Eureka Heritage Society.
